Opendoor Technologies Inc. (OPEN) — AI Stock Analysis
Opendoor Technologies Inc. is a digital platform transforming residential real estate by enabling consumers to seamlessly buy and sell homes online. The company also offers integrated title insurance and escrow services, streamlining the entire transaction process.

Growth Opportunities
- Geographic Expansion: Opendoor has the opportunity to expand its services to new markets across the United States. The total addressable market for residential real estate transactions is substantial, and entering new geographic regions would significantly increase Opendoor's revenue potential. This expansion can be achieved through strategic market analysis, targeted marketing campaigns, and partnerships with local real estate professionals. The timeline for expansion is ongoing, with plans to enter several new markets within the next 2-3 years.
- Increased Adoption of Integrated Services: Opendoor can drive growth by increasing the adoption of its integrated title insurance and escrow services among its customers. By offering a seamless, end-to-end transaction experience, Opendoor can capture a larger share of the revenue associated with each real estate transaction. This can be achieved through bundling incentives, enhanced customer education, and streamlined integration of these services into the platform. The timeline for increased adoption is immediate and ongoing.
- Refinement of Pricing Algorithms: Opendoor's pricing algorithms are critical to its success, and continuous refinement of these algorithms can drive significant growth. By leveraging data analytics and machine learning, Opendoor can improve the accuracy of its home valuations, leading to increased transaction volume and profitability. This requires ongoing investment in data science and engineering capabilities. The timeline for algorithm refinement is continuous.
- Strategic Partnerships: Opendoor can forge strategic partnerships with other companies in the real estate ecosystem, such as mortgage lenders, home improvement companies, and moving services providers. These partnerships can enhance Opendoor's service offering, attract new customers, and generate additional revenue streams. The timeline for establishing strategic partnerships is ongoing, with potential for several new partnerships within the next year.
- Expansion into Adjacent Services: Opendoor can expand its service offering beyond buying and selling homes to include adjacent services such as property management, home renovation, and interior design. This would allow Opendoor to capture a larger share of the customer's wallet and create a more comprehensive real estate solution. The timeline for expansion into adjacent services is longer-term, with potential for pilot programs within the next 3-5 years.

What does Opendoor Technologies Inc. do?
Opendoor Technologies Inc. operates a digital platform that revolutionizes the way people buy and sell homes. Unlike traditional real estate processes, Opendoor provides a streamlined, online experience where sellers can receive instant offers on their homes, bypassing the need for showings and lengthy negotiations. The company also facilitates home purchases through its platform, offering a wide selection of properties and self-guided tours. Furthermore, Opendoor enhances the transaction process by providing integrated title insurance and escrow services, creating a seamless, end-to-end experience for its customers. This innovative approach positions Opendoor as a disruptor in the real estate industry, catering to consumers seeking convenience and efficiency.

What are the main risks for OPEN?
Opendoor faces several key risks that investors should be aware of. The company is highly susceptible to fluctuations in the housing market and interest rates, which can impact its ability to accurately price homes and maintain profitability. Competition from traditional real estate brokerages and other technology-driven platforms poses a constant threat to its market share. Inaccurate pricing algorithms could lead to losses on home sales. Additionally, cybersecurity risks and data breaches could compromise sensitive customer information and damage the company's reputation. Changes in regulations affecting the real estate industry could also negatively impact Opendoor's business model.
